FACTOR COMPLETELY 2X^2-19X+24

OpenStudy (anonymous):

first you find all the factors that would multiply to get you 24 and they would both be negitive so that you will get negitive 19

OpenStudy (anonymous):

to get 2x^2 it will half to be (2x- )(x- ) the factors you can use to get 24 are 1 and 24, 2 and 12, 3 and 8, and 6 and 4 since you need a odd number you would plug the only one with an od number in where it wont be multiplied with 2 so it would look like (2x-3)(x-8)<=====answer or if u want to further simplify it it would be 2(x-3)(x-8)

OpenStudy (radar):

2(x-3)(x-8) = 2x^2-22x+48 Not 2x^2-19x+24

OpenStudy (radar):

The correct answer was (2x-3)(x-8) not the further simplified answer.
